Side effects of bone marrow transplant

Immature stem cells in the bone marrow (soft, fatty tissue inside your bones) give rise to blood cells. These blood cells mature and enter the bloodstream. In bone marrow transplant, damaged and destroyed bone marrow is replaced with healthy bone marrow stem cells removed from you or from a donor.
